About 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ide
2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ide (PubChem CID 1481018) has the molecular formula C16H14Cl4N2O4S
and a molecular weight of 472.18 g/mol. Its IUPAC name is 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ide.

What is the SMILES notation for 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ide?
The canonical SMILES for 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ide is COc1cc(N(CC(=O)Nc2ccc(Cl)cc2Cl)S(C)(=O)=O)c(Cl)cc1Cl.
What is the InChIKey of 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ide?
The InChIKey is NZBUZUSROHMVIB-UHFFFAOYSA-N. The full InChI is InChI=1S/C16H14Cl4N2O4S/c1-26-15-7-14(11(19)6-12(15)20)22(27(2,24)25)8-16(23)21-13-4-3-9(17)5-10(13)18/h3-7H,8H2,1-2H3,(H,21,23).
What are the key properties of 2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ide?
2-(2,4-dichloro-5-methoxy-N-methylsulfonylanilino)-N-(2,4-dichlorophenyl)acetamide has a molecular weight of 472.18 g/mol, XLogP of 4.71, 6 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
